There will be a lot of airplane gazing going on at NBAA 2015 that runs between November 17 and 19th, and one of the new aircraft at the show will be the Diamond Aircraft seven-seat DA62 Twin.

The DA62 is intended to fill a gap in the market that ranges from high performance single pistons to entry level turboprops. Diamond describes their aircraft as a flying SUV because it offers optional three row seven passenger seating, large payload and low fuel burn. It incorporates composite airplane construction, jet fuel piston powerplants and advanced avionics integration. he SkiGull, which is a next-generation seaplane developed by Rutan and Regan Designs has begun its initial testing. Burt Rutan, along with a group of skilled supporters, placed his SkiGull in the water for the first time and commenced with testing its water capabilities. Science Fiction became science fact in New York last week when an aviator flew by jetpack in a controlled and sustained flight around Statue of Liberty. Soaring high across the Hudson River, Australian entrepreneur David Mayman became the first person to prove the viability of personal flying devices. Mayman's flight was the culmination of a 10 year challenge to design and build a light-weight, wearable flying device that will allow people to take to the skies.
